Reading the musical resume of Pete Nolan (aka Spectre Folk) has brought back vivid memories of a thrilling time for new music discovery. Pete was a drummer for Magik Markers, a (Connecticut/Massachusetts?) band that had somehow conjured up an infamous reputation for violent free rock that me and 3 other friends just had to hear! I did manage to get some CDs, and flogged them, but lost track of their evolution and associated acts.

That’s where Sophomore Lounge Records steps in, doing what they do best, joining the dots and giving us all a way into the ‘lifers’ and bypassing the opportunistic ‘lifestylers’.

Spectre Folk’s ‘Quabbin Winter’ has stayed close to the turntable since we got it and I grow more fond of it with every listen. A laid-back-but-with-tubes-still-running-hot take on psychedelic rock, like ‘Cats & Dogs’ era Royal Trux, or Spacemen 3 meets a particular USA underground sensibility that spans the likes of Strapping Fieldhands to Sic Alps (who helped out with this recording!).

I wonder what else I’ve missed from the Magik Markers crew??? Oh well at least I’ve got this one! - Nic
